There is one episode that has my favorite obscure reference of all time. Throughout the episode, Mac is wearing a "What are you looking at Dicknose" T-shirt. That shirt, of course, was worn prominently by the character Styles in the 80's classic Teen Wolf. The person who directed the episode was Jerry Levine who played Styles.
